claude for small business is anthropic's packaged offering for small companies: around 15 ready-to-run workflows across finance, ops, sales, marketing, hr, and support, wired into tools like quickbooks, stripe, paypal, hubspot, and canva, with one rule at the center: claude does the task, and you approve before anything is sent, posted, or paid. that last line is the whole thing, and it is the same rule i have been teaching for a year.
this matters because access has never been the problem. about 85% of people already had access to ai, and only about 25% used it on real work (see the ai adoption gap). a packaged product narrows that gap. it does not close it.
what actually shipped
- 15-ish workflows across the parts of a business you actually run: invoicing and close in quickbooks, settlements in paypal, lead triage in hubspot, on-brand content in canva.
- real integrations, so ai acts inside the tools you already use instead of in a separate chat window.
- a human-in-the-loop rule: claude drafts and does the work, you approve before it goes out. that is not a limitation. it is the operating manual.
- free training and a 10-city tour, plus a solopreneur accelerator, aimed squarely at closing the small-business adoption gap.
the part it won't do for you
a workflow is a starting point, not a setup. here is the difference, and it is the difference between the 25% and everyone else:
| what the product gives you | what still makes it work |
|---|---|
| 15 generic workflows | pointing one at the exact job you do all week (delegation) |
| a capable model | your voice, your data, your rules baked in (description) |
| an approve button | the judgment to catch the confident wrong answer (discernment) |
